Change it just before it breaks :-)

You'd probably be very unlucky if you stuck to 60k and had one break on you.
But the belt itself is only half of the story. If the belt drives the water
pump (as it does on most if not all Audis) then the pump will break the belt
(or strip its teeth) if the pump seizes. BTDT...

Throw some numbers up in the air and what your left with is the recomended
service date for timing belt change.

The long and short of it is, stick to 60k if you can afford it.

Here is the Audi Official times, according to a UK manual

40k miles - RS4/ 2.7 V6 biturbo

60k miles - TDI Engines

80k miles - 2.4 V6 /3.0V6 /V6 TDI

115k miles - 1.8 4-cylinder engines / 2.0 4 cylinder engines

But knowing the history of frequent premature TB/tensioner failures,
especially on the 1.8T engines, every 60K miles or 4-5 years would be a
safer bet.
